Below are some common figures … WebApr 7, 2024 · Medusa, in Greek mythology, the most famous of the monster figures known as Gorgons. She was usually represented as a winged female creature having a head of hair consisting of snakes; unlike the Gorgons, she was sometimes represented as very beautiful. Medusa was the only Gorgon who was mortal; hence her slayer, Perseus, was …

WebHe did not have a head for figures; Ants may not be very bright, but it seems they have a head for figures; It turned out he didn't have a head for business.; You have to have a head for miscellaneous, stupid details for this job,; However, he had discovered during this time that he did have a head for business.; Goldhammer said, " but I don't have a head … Webhave a head for (something) 1. To have the mental ability to do something well. I've always been good at math—I guess I just have a head for numbers. 2. To have the ability to withstand or endure something.
